About This Resource

No-prep SEL worksheets for grades 3-5 that teach students about including others. These print-and-go worksheets help students recognize when someone may feel left out, reflect on exclusion, and identify practical ways to help others feel included.

With this resource, you'll be able to:

  • Introduce inclusion in clear, student-friendly language.
  • Guide discussion on why people may be left out and how exclusion can feel.
  • Help students identify practical ways to include others.
  • Send worksheets home so families can continue the conversation.

 

What's Included

Including Others Worksheets

Five worksheets help students explore what it means to include others and what they can do when someone is left out. Each one includes a discussion question and a short activity to apply what they have learned.

  • 5 worksheets, 2 pages each
  • Discussion question and student activity on each worksheet
  • Printable PDFs in color and black and white
  • Digital Google Slides version with fill-in text boxes

10 pages | PDF + Google Slides | Black & white included


What These Worksheets Cover

  1. Introduce what it means to make sure others feel included.
  2. Discuss how differences can sometimes lead people to be left out.
  3. Reflect on times they have felt left out or excluded.
  4. Explore practical ways to include others.
  5. Reflect on what they learned and how they can get started.
